Subject: [PATCH] jfs: add a check to prevent array-index-out-of-bounds
Date: Wed,  9 Oct 2024 01:51:38 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20241008202137.8577-1-niharchaithanya@gmail.com> (raw)

When the value of lp is 1 at the end of the iteration in the for loop,
lp is modified in the next iteration to a negative value.
Add a check to prevent this condition.

 fs/jfs/jfs_dmap.c | 6 ++++++
 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+)

diff --git a/fs/jfs/jfs_dmap.c b/fs/jfs/jfs_dmap.c
index 5713994328cb..3ebb2dfdd0b3 100644
--- a/fs/jfs/jfs_dmap.c
+++ b/fs/jfs/jfs_dmap.c
@@ -2911,6 +2911,12 @@ static void dbAdjTree(dmtree_t *tp, int leafno, int newval, bool is_ctl)
 		 */
 		tp->dmt_stree[pp] = max;
 
+		/* check to prevent negative value of lp on the
+		 * next iteration.
+		 */
+		if (lp == 1)
+			break;
+
 		/* parent becomes leaf for next go-round.
 		 */
 		lp = pp;
